Many people ask me what type of attorney I am. My answer is one who is laid back and honest with clients. I treat clients how I would want to be treated. Simply put ... I give the legal advice the clients needs to hear not the legal advice they want to hear.
My interests are Cincinnati Bengals football, UD Flyer college basketball, the Cincinnati Reds, and my new passion boxing.
Im an elected Kettering City Councilman, write a weekly column for the Dayton City Paper, member of the Kettering Rotary, member of the Dayton Masonic Lodge, and many other associations.
